Not more than one building designed or available for use for
dwelling purposes shall be erected or placed or converted to use as
such on any lot in a subdivision, or elsewhere in the Town of Palmer,
without the consent of the Board. Such consent may be conditional
upon the providing of adequate ways furnishing access to each site
for such building in the same manner as otherwise required for lots
within a subdivision.

In the Town of Palmer, certain services are provided to subdivisions
under the jurisdiction of various Town departments and other quasi-public
agencies. Compliance with the applicable regulations and requirements
of these agencies and departments shall be required before a definitive
plan is approved by the Planning Board, at a regularly scheduled meeting,
and certification and installation of respective utilities shall be
required before the performance guarantee can be reduced or released.
No person shall make a subdivision, within the meaning of the
Subdivision Control Law, of any land within the Town, or proceed with
the improvement or sale of lots in a subdivision, or the construction
of ways, or the installation of municipal services therein, unless
and until a definitive plan of such subdivision has been submitted
to, approved and endorsed by the Board as hereinafter provided, and
recorded at the Hampden County Registry of Deeds.
The recording of a plan of land within the Town in the Registry
of Deeds of Hampden County prior to the effective date of the Subdivision
Control Law in the Town of Palmer, showing the division thereof into
existing or proposed lots, sites or other divisions and ways furnishing
access thereto, shall not exempt such land from the application and
operation of these Rules and Regulations, except as specifically exempt
by MGL c. 41, § 81FF of the Subdivision Control Law.
No plan of a subdivision shall be approved unless all of the
building lots shown on the plan comply with the Zoning Bylaws of the
Town of Palmer, Massachusetts.
The Planning Board may, in special and appropriate cases, require
the developer to follow more stringent standards than the ones mentioned
in these Rules and Regulations. In doing so, the Board shall notify
the developer in writing of said standards and the reason they are
required.
The preliminary and definitive plans shall be prepared by a
registered land surveyor and construction details shall be designed
by a registered professional engineer.
